About the role:

We are seeking a skilled and experienced Traveling Lead Field Controls Technician to oversee the installation, testing, and commissioning of Building Management Systems (BMS) on construction projects. The Lead Controls Technician will lead a team of on-site technicians to ensure all control systems are properly integrated, functioning according to specifications, and ready for handover to the client, including thorough documentation and quality control throughout the process.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Coordinate/supervise installation sub-contractors schedule and scope of work to ensure successful completion.
  • Develop and execute detailed commissioning plans, including functional testing, sequence of operations, point-to-point verification, and system calibration for BMS systems.
  • Lead on-site commissioning activities, including wiring, termination, point-to-point verification, and system integration with other building systems (HVAC, lighting, security).
  • Interpret blueprints and other technical documents and explain them to on-site Controls Technicians.
  • Provide day-to-day technical coaching and support to on-site Controls Technicians, assigning tasks, providing technical guidance, and ensuring efficient project execution.
  • Collaborate with project managers, engineers, architects, and customers to address concerns, clarify requirements, and facilitate smooth project completion.
  • Identify and resolve technical issues with BMS systems, including hardware malfunctions, software errors, and communication problems.
  • Prepare comprehensive commissioning reports, including test results, deviations, corrective actions, and system documentation for handover.
  • Provide technical support and basic training to customers.
  • Schedule weekly check in with Project Manager for project completion status in DivPro and manpower updates.
  • Submit parts orders in DivPro for miscellaneous parts.
  • Review & submit QA/QC documents to Project Manager for final review.
  • Ensure compliance with safety regulations and industry standards during all operations.
